Information Centre of Rostov NPP Honors Participants of ТNuclear Science and TechnologyУ Contest

On May 15, 2012 participants of the regional stage of the All-Russian contest of abstract and creative works ТNuclear Science and TechnologyУ met together in the Information Centre of Rostov NPP.



Looking back, the official debriefing of the regional stage of the ТNuclear Science and TechnologyУ contest was held on April 20 in Rostov-on-Don on base of the Information Centre for Nuclear Energy. Volgodonsk at this event was represented by three young scientists, and in general in the contest there participated more than 30 Volgodonsk school students and preschool children. Each of them received the deserved awards from Rostov Р the certificates and letters of appreciation, valuable prizes and gifts. Presentation was held in a festive atmosphere. All the guys and girls were happy, and expressed their readiness to take part in the next contests.

Rostov NPP is a branch of Rosenergoatom Concern OJSC. The enterprise is situated on the bank of Tsimlyansk Reservoir at 13,5 km from Volgodonsk. NPP operates two power units with VVER-1000 reactors with the capacity of 1,000 MW. Unit 1 was commissioned in 2001 and Unit 2 Р in December 2010. Power Units 3 and 4 are nowadays under construction.
